feat(dashboard): add DisableLogin + AutoLoginUser options (default off)

This commit is contained in:
Joseph Doherty
2026-06-16 08:11:10 -04:00
parent a894717319
commit 073252d7a6
2 changed files with 29 additions and 0 deletions
@@ -121,6 +121,18 @@ public sealed class GatewayOptionsTests
StringComparison.Ordinal);
}
[Fact]
public void DashboardOptions_DisableLogin_DefaultsToFalse()
{
Assert.False(new DashboardOptions().DisableLogin);
}
[Fact]
public void DashboardOptions_AutoLoginUser_DefaultsToNull()
{
Assert.Null(new DashboardOptions().AutoLoginUser);
}
private static GatewayOptions BindOptions(IReadOnlyDictionary<string, string?> configurationValues)
{
using ServiceProvider services = BuildServices(configurationValues);